Title: Clinical analysis of curative effects of Omeprazole plus Dailixin on functional dyspepsia
Abstract: Objective To compare the efficacy of Dailixin plus omeprazole with that of omeprazole in the treatment of functional dyspepsia(FD),and three-month relapse of them.Methods 110 patients with FD were divided into observing group(n=60) and control group(n=50) randomly.The former group was administered with Dailixin and omeprazole,and the latter one with omeprazole.Their clinical symptoms were compared.Results The effective rate and three-month relapse rate were respectively 95.0% and 13.3% in the observing group,while the counterparts of the control group were 88.0% and 24.0%.There were significant differences in the parameters between the two groups(P0.05).Conclusion Dailixin plus omeprazole is safe and effective in the treatment of FD.Maintaining treament is required in many patients.
